Leading Companies in Industrial Automation: Siemens, Allen-Bradley, ABB, and Schneider

The industrial control systems sector is dominated by a few key players who provide a wide selection of solutions for control in various applications. Siemens, Allen-Bradley, ABB, and Schneider consistently rank among the leading names in this field, known for their reliable products and extensive expertise.

  • Siemens, a global powerhouse, offers a diverse portfolio of industrial control systems, including PLCs, HMIs, drives, and software. They are particularly renowned for their expertise in automation for manufacturing, energy, and infrastructure projects.
  • Allen-Bradley, a subsidiary of Rockwell Automation, is a respected name in the industrial control systems industry. They are known for their modular automation solutions, particularly in the areas of manufacturing and process control.
  • ABB, a multinational company focused on electrification, robotics, and automation, provides a wide range of industrial control systems serving diverse industries. Their strengths lie in power grids, robotics, and industrial automation.
  • Schneider Electric, a global specialist in energy management and automation, offers a comprehensive suite of industrial control systems, including PLCs, HMIs, devices, and software solutions. They are particularly strong in the areas of building automation and renewable systems.
